Blackwater Extraction

We extract blackwater first, before any other remediation step, to stop the contamination from spreading further.

Contaminated Material Removal

Carpet, padding, drywall, and insulation that absorbed blackwater are removed, since Category 3 water makes porous materials unsalvageable.

Antimicrobial Treatment

Antimicrobial treatment follows removal on every job, since bacteria remain a risk even after visible water is gone.

Structural Drying & Dehumidification

We track drying progress with moisture meters rather than guessing when a structure is actually dry.

Sewer Backup Source Assessment

Technicians assess likely backup causes — tree root intrusion, municipal line issues, or sump pump failure — to help prevent recurrence.

Odor & Residual Contamination Treatment

Odor treatment is the final step, applied only after the underlying contamination has been fully addressed.

Why can't you just clean the carpet instead of removing it? +

Category 3 blackwater contamination makes porous materials like carpet padding unsalvageable under IICRC S500 standards, regardless of how they look.

Will insurance cover the cost of Sewage Cleanup cleanup? +

Many homeowner's policies cover sewage backup remediation under specific circumstances, and we supply documentation adjusters typically request.

How long does structural drying take? +

Drying typically runs two to four days with industrial equipment, tracked with moisture readings until levels return to normal.

What usually causes a sewage backup? +

We assess the likely cause on-site, which is often tree roots, a clogged main line, or pump failure.
